Museum Significance

Bargello Palace, the museum’s home, is a prominent fixture in Europe, renowned for housing significant sculptures by celebrated artists like Michelangelo and Donatello.
The Bargello Museum’s collection boasts masterpieces such as Donatello’s iconic "David" and "St. George," as well as Michelangelo’s captivating "Bacchus" and "Tondo Pitti."
These works, along with pieces by other renowned Renaissance sculptors like Bartolomeo Ammannati, Benvenuto Cellini, and Giambologna, make the Bargello a must-visit destination for art enthusiasts and history buffs alike.
Exploring this renowned museum’s halls provides a unique window into the artistic genius of the Italian Renaissance, cementing its status as a cultural treasure of Florence.
Key Artworks

Visitors to the Bargello Museum will find themselves captivated by several key artworks that define the museum’s exceptional collection.
These masterpieces include:
-
Donatello’s celebrated sculptures "David" and "St. George", showcasing the artist’s unparalleled skill in rendering the human form.
-
Michelangelo’s impressive "Bacchus" and the exquisite "Tondo Pitti", which exemplify his groundbreaking approach to the classical tradition.
-
Benvenuto Cellini’s intricate bronze "Perseus with the Head of Medusa", a testament to his technical virtuosity.
-
Giambologna’s dynamic "Rape of the Sabine Women", a dramatic depiction of the legendary event.
-
The Della Robbia family’s stunning glazed terracotta works, which adorn the museum’s second-floor exhibits.
